Glenn v. Spectrum
Plaintiff: Constance Glenn
Defendant: Spectrum
Case Number: 3:2022cv00065
Filed: April 8, 2022
Court: US District Court for the Northern District of Georgia
Presiding Judge: Timothy C Batten
Nature of Suit: Contract: Other
Cause of Action: 28 U.S.C. ยง 1331 Fed. Question: Breach of Contract
Jury Demanded By: None

Date Filed Document Text
May 4, 2022 Filing 6 CLERK'S JUDGMENT (dmb)--Please refer to http://www.ca11.uscourts.gov to obtain an appeals jurisdiction checklist--
May 4, 2022 Opinion or Order Filing 5 ORDER dismissing this action without prejudice for failure to prosecute and failure comply with the Courts order that she file a properly amended complaint. Signed by Judge Timothy C. Batten, Sr. on 5/4/2022. (dmb)
May 4, 2022 Civil Case Terminated. (dmb)
May 4, 2022 Clerk's Certificate of Mailing as to Constance Glenn re #6 Clerk's Judgment, #5 Order. (dmb)
April 12, 2022 Opinion or Order Filing 4 ORDER directing Plaintiff to file an amended complaint within 21 days that that identifies the legal basis for his claim, facts supporting it, and a prayer for relief. Failure to do so will constitute a violation of a lawful court order resulting in dismissal under Local Rule 43.1 and failure to state a claim under 1915(e)(2)(B). Signed by Judge Timothy C. Batten, Sr. on 4/12/2022. (dmb)
April 12, 2022 Filing 3 COMPLAINT filed by Constance Glenn.(dmb) Please visit our website at http://www.gand.uscourts.gov/commonly-used-forms to obtain Pretrial Instructions and Pretrial Associated Forms which includes the Consent To Proceed Before U.S. Magistrate form.
April 12, 2022 Opinion or Order Filing 2 ORDER GRANTING In Forma Pauperis. Service of Process shall not issue at present time. The Clerk is directed to submit this file to the assigned District Judge for a frivolity determination. Signed by Magistrate Judge Russell G. Vineyard on 4/12/2022. (dmb)
April 12, 2022 Submission of #3 Complaint to District Judge Timothy C. Batten Sr. (dmb)
April 12, 2022 Clerk's Certificate of Mailing as to Constance Glenn re #2 Order ruling on IFP,, Order that Service of Process shall not issue at present time. (dmb)
April 12, 2022 Clerk's Certificate of Mailing as to Constance Glenn re #4 Order. (dmb)
April 11, 2022 Submission of #1 APPLICATION for Leave to Proceed in forma pauperis, to Magistrate Judge Russell G. Vineyard. (dmb)
April 8, 2022 Filing 1 APPLICATION for Leave to Proceed in forma pauperis by Constance Glenn. (Attachments: #1 Complaint)(dmb)
